Hugh Nimmo-Smith
|
1976451c81
|
Lint
|
2022-10-17 12:23:14 +01:00 |
Hugh Nimmo-Smith
|
3be4a0ca21
|
Remove unused val
|
2022-10-17 11:25:09 +01:00 |
Hugh Nimmo-Smith
|
a3fc785945
|
Fix missing param
|
2022-10-14 18:52:42 +01:00 |
Hugh Nimmo-Smith
|
bfe3daa37f
|
Fix compile error from bad merge
|
2022-10-14 17:25:06 +01:00 |
Hugh Nimmo-Smith
|
fdc55965ca
|
Linting
|
2022-10-14 17:23:26 +01:00 |
Hugh Nimmo-Smith
|
dc9b41d19a
|
Merge branch 'feature/ons/qr_code_login_ui' into feature/hughns/qr_code_login
|
2022-10-14 17:12:08 +01:00 |
Onuray Sahin
|
6c10a9bf2d
|
Code review fixes.
|
2022-10-14 18:10:18 +03:00 |
Onuray Sahin
|
e83bdc3779
|
Use correct homeserver url to check qr code login support.
|
2022-10-14 17:46:14 +03:00 |
Hugh Nimmo-Smith
|
4325600d27
|
Merge branch 'feature/ons/qr_code_login_ui' into feature/hughns/qr_code_login
|
2022-10-14 13:57:04 +01:00 |
Onuray Sahin
|
5953346b3d
|
Merge branch 'develop' into feature/ons/qr_code_login_ui
# Conflicts:
# library/ui-strings/src/main/res/values/strings.xml
# matrix-sdk-android/src/main/java/org/matrix/android/sdk/api/auth/AuthenticationService.kt
# matrix-sdk-android/src/main/java/org/matrix/android/sdk/internal/auth/DefaultAuthenticationService.kt
# matrix-sdk-android/src/main/java/org/matrix/android/sdk/internal/database/migration/MigrateSessionTo038.kt
# vector-app/src/debug/java/im/vector/app/features/debug/features/DebugFeaturesStateFactory.kt
# vector-app/src/debug/java/im/vector/app/features/debug/features/DebugVectorFeatures.kt
# vector/src/main/java/im/vector/app/features/VectorFeatures.kt
|
2022-10-14 15:17:55 +03:00 |
Hugh Nimmo-Smith
|
626e3dbd10
|
Merge pull request #7358 from vector-im/feature/hughns/qr_code_login_task
|
2022-10-14 09:38:07 +01:00 |
Jorge Martin Espinosa
|
81ef1415dc
|
Apply design changes to WYSIWYG editor (#7354)
* Apply design changes to WYSIWYG editor
* Add changelog
* Remove unneeded attribute in RichTextComposerLayout
* Fix lint issues
* Fix style naming issue.
* Change rich text editor border radius depending on the number of lines.
* Replace standby voice recorder icon.
|
2022-10-14 09:59:43 +02:00 |
Hugh Nimmo-Smith
|
de4232dff5
|
Fix logic for showing confirm button
|
2022-10-14 06:17:48 +01:00 |
Hugh Nimmo-Smith
|
d72371906e
|
Add flag to allow QR login on all servers + split flag for showing in device manager
|
2022-10-14 06:17:48 +01:00 |
Hugh Nimmo-Smith
|
efa70fa0ff
|
Revert "Retry scanning if not a QR code"
This reverts commit 87956e9438 .
|
2022-10-14 06:17:48 +01:00 |
Hugh Nimmo-Smith
|
4c7c86100f
|
Fix logic for showing confirm button
|
2022-10-14 02:04:08 +01:00 |
Hugh Nimmo-Smith
|
343cf74871
|
Add flag to allow QR login on all servers + split flag for showing in device manager
|
2022-10-14 01:45:03 +01:00 |
Hugh Nimmo-Smith
|
c00ce91214
|
Linting
|
2022-10-14 01:11:25 +01:00 |
Hugh Nimmo-Smith
|
c18439f99b
|
Refactor code into api from internal
|
2022-10-14 01:07:19 +01:00 |
Hugh Nimmo-Smith
|
f04f0e6fac
|
Revert "Revert "Partial implementation of QR login logic""
This reverts commit e305478dda .
|
2022-10-13 22:42:58 +01:00 |
Hugh Nimmo-Smith
|
958ee2d356
|
Revert "Revert "Retry scanning if not a QR code""
This reverts commit 9429a4f22a .
|
2022-10-13 22:32:02 +01:00 |
Hugh Nimmo-Smith
|
dd47297dfd
|
QR login + E2EE set up
|
2022-10-13 22:14:55 +01:00 |
Hugh Nimmo-Smith
|
9a72d6529b
|
Support for navigation to home screen
|
2022-10-13 22:13:56 +01:00 |
Hugh Nimmo-Smith
|
991eeb1de6
|
Map for soft logout
|
2022-10-13 22:13:56 +01:00 |
Hugh Nimmo-Smith
|
b03240330d
|
Only do completeOnNewDevice if we received a confirmation code
|
2022-10-13 22:13:55 +01:00 |
Onuray Sahin
|
ef574bd82f
|
Merge branch 'develop' into feature/ons/qr_code_login_ui
# Conflicts:
# library/ui-strings/src/main/res/values/strings.xml
# library/ui-styles/src/main/res/values/stylable_sessions_list_header_view.xml
# vector-app/src/debug/java/im/vector/app/features/debug/features/DebugFeaturesStateFactory.kt
# vector-app/src/debug/java/im/vector/app/features/debug/features/DebugVectorFeatures.kt
# vector/src/main/java/im/vector/app/core/di/MavericksViewModelModule.kt
# vector/src/main/java/im/vector/app/features/VectorFeatures.kt
# vector/src/main/java/im/vector/app/features/settings/devices/v2/VectorSettingsDevicesFragment.kt
# vector/src/main/java/im/vector/app/features/settings/devices/v2/list/SessionsListHeaderView.kt
# vector/src/main/res/layout/fragment_other_sessions.xml
# vector/src/main/res/layout/fragment_settings_devices.xml
|
2022-10-13 22:13:55 +01:00 |
Hugh Nimmo-Smith
|
bfab07d716
|
Partial implementation of QR login logic
|
2022-10-13 22:13:55 +01:00 |
Hugh Nimmo-Smith
|
9429a4f22a
|
Revert "Retry scanning if not a QR code"
This reverts commit 87956e9438 .
|
2022-10-13 21:48:33 +01:00 |
Hugh Nimmo-Smith
|
e305478dda
|
Revert "Partial implementation of QR login logic"
This reverts commit 4b14ee4695 .
|
2022-10-13 21:48:25 +01:00 |
Hugh Nimmo-Smith
|
90fa5d5345
|
Revert "Only do completeOnNewDevice if we received a confirmation code"
This reverts commit 6e58f2fa51 .
|
2022-10-13 21:48:21 +01:00 |
Hugh Nimmo-Smith
|
e554b43bc6
|
Merge branch 'feature/ons/qr_code_login_ui' of https://github.com/vector-im/element-android into feature/ons/qr_code_login_ui
|
2022-10-13 21:27:09 +01:00 |
Onuray Sahin
|
fb2776dca4
|
Cherry pick previous commits.
|
2022-10-13 20:33:52 +03:00 |
Hugh Nimmo-Smith
|
738242c837
|
Map for soft logout
|
2022-10-13 16:28:47 +01:00 |
Benoit Marty
|
5b56ae1e1c
|
Merge pull request #7319 from ByeongsuPark/feature/bspark/bugfix-wrong-mic-direction-rtl
Fix the wrong mic button direction to cancel on RTL languages
|
2022-10-13 13:59:09 +02:00 |
Benoit Marty
|
92a2420952
|
Merge pull request #7293 from vector-im/feature/bma/android13
Android 13
|
2022-10-13 13:52:52 +02:00 |
Maxime NATUREL
|
f9eb6a64ea
|
Merge pull request #7323 from vector-im/feature/mna/device-manager-parsing-os
[Device management] Improve the parsing for OS of Desktop/Web sessions (PSG-823)
|
2022-10-13 10:39:38 +02:00 |
Eric Decanini
|
963c0e5a50
|
Local Notification Settings Event (#7300)
* Adds push notifications switch
* Adds functionality to Push notification toggle
* Adds DefaultPushersServiceTest for togglePusher
* Adds DefaultTogglePusherTaskTest
* Adds SessionOverviewViewModelTest for toggling pusher
* Hides pusher toggle if there are no pushers of the device
* Adds changelog file
* Edits changelog file
* Fixes copyrights
* Unregisters checkedChangelistener in onDetachedFromWindow for switch view
* Links notification settings toggle to pusher service
* Adds changelog file
* Adds error handling to VectorSettingsNotificationPreferenceFragment
* Removes comment in FakePushersService
* Adds parsing for LocalNotificationSettings event
* Adds changelog file
* Fixes post merge errors
* Fixes imports and improves string name
* Fixes legal copies
* Fixes kdoc punctuation
* Fixes string error
* Removes unused imports
* Moves LocalNotificationSettingsContent
* Fixes lint errors
* Fixes test errors
* Fixes test errors
* Fixes error
* Fixes error
* Fixes error
* Fixes error
* Fixes error
* Fixes error
* Fixes error
* Adds lost tests
* Adds PusherEntity migration
* Fixes session overview layout overlap
* Fixes switch being enabled by default
* Adds device id and unstable prefix
|
2022-10-12 23:11:27 -04:00 |
Maxime NATUREL
|
f8f416e979
|
Merge pull request #7306 from vector-im/feature/mna/device-manager-extended-details
[Device Management] Render extended device info (PSG-773)
|
2022-10-12 18:09:33 +02:00 |
Benoit Marty
|
beb334babe
|
Merge pull request #7335 from vector-im/feature/bma/upgrade_arrow
Remove Arrow-kt dependency
|
2022-10-12 16:26:02 +02:00 |
Maxime NATUREL
|
7877ef92cc
|
Merge pull request #7325 from vector-im/feature/mna/device-manager-hide-ip-current-session
[Device management] Hide the IP address and last activity date on current session (PSG-823)
|
2022-10-12 15:56:30 +02:00 |
Maxime NATUREL
|
6626732b3b
|
Merge pull request #7276 from vector-im/feature/mna/device-manager-account-data
[Device Management] Save matrix_client_information events on login/registration (PSG-769, PSG-771)
|
2022-10-12 15:41:40 +02:00 |
Eric Decanini
|
9857fa6ca4
|
Makes "Enable Notifications for this session" respond to enabled value in pusher (#7281)
* Adds push notifications switch
* Adds functionality to Push notification toggle
* Adds DefaultPushersServiceTest for togglePusher
* Adds DefaultTogglePusherTaskTest
* Adds SessionOverviewViewModelTest for toggling pusher
* Hides pusher toggle if there are no pushers of the device
* Adds changelog file
* Edits changelog file
* Fixes copyrights
* Unregisters checkedChangelistener in onDetachedFromWindow for switch view
* Links notification settings toggle to pusher service
* Adds changelog file
* Adds error handling to VectorSettingsNotificationPreferenceFragment
* Removes comment in FakePushersService
* Fixes post merge errors
* Fixes imports and improves string name
* Fixes legal copies
* Fixes kdoc punctuation
* Fixes string error
* Removes unused imports
* Fixes lint errors
* Fixes test errors
* Fixes test errors
* Fixes error
* Fixes error
* Fixes error
* Fixes error
* Fixes error
* Adds lost tests
* Adds PusherEntity migration
* Fixes session overview layout overlap
* Fixes switch being enabled by default
* Binds entire view to toggle switch
|
2022-10-12 09:27:55 -04:00 |
Maxime NATUREL
|
cf9f30d95e
|
Merge pull request #7337 from vector-im/feature/mna/device-manager-lab-flag
[Device management] Add lab flag for the feature (PSG-793)
|
2022-10-12 14:16:53 +02:00 |
Hugh Nimmo-Smith
|
6e58f2fa51
|
Only do completeOnNewDevice if we received a confirmation code
|
2022-10-12 13:08:01 +01:00 |
Onuray Sahin
|
1e1affbb7b
|
Merge branch 'develop' into feature/ons/qr_code_login_ui
# Conflicts:
# library/ui-strings/src/main/res/values/strings.xml
# library/ui-styles/src/main/res/values/stylable_sessions_list_header_view.xml
# vector-app/src/debug/java/im/vector/app/features/debug/features/DebugFeaturesStateFactory.kt
# vector-app/src/debug/java/im/vector/app/features/debug/features/DebugVectorFeatures.kt
# vector/src/main/java/im/vector/app/core/di/MavericksViewModelModule.kt
# vector/src/main/java/im/vector/app/features/VectorFeatures.kt
# vector/src/main/java/im/vector/app/features/settings/devices/v2/VectorSettingsDevicesFragment.kt
# vector/src/main/java/im/vector/app/features/settings/devices/v2/list/SessionsListHeaderView.kt
# vector/src/main/res/layout/fragment_other_sessions.xml
# vector/src/main/res/layout/fragment_settings_devices.xml
|
2022-10-12 14:32:09 +03:00 |
Maxime NATUREL
|
9f006a2940
|
Fixing navigation to session details + layout in session overview screen
|
2022-10-12 11:06:59 +02:00 |
Benoit Marty
|
1669316682
|
Remove dependency to arrow. Please use `org.matrix.android.sdk.api.util.Optional` instead.
|
2022-10-12 10:20:52 +02:00 |
Hugh Nimmo-Smith
|
4b14ee4695
|
Partial implementation of QR login logic
|
2022-10-11 23:34:05 +01:00 |
Hugh Nimmo-Smith
|
87956e9438
|
Retry scanning if not a QR code
|
2022-10-11 23:32:49 +01:00 |
Onuray Sahin
|
d8ea9c8215
|
Add flag for qr code login.
|
2022-10-11 20:04:18 +03:00 |